One Girl Can was born out of a need to recognize and reward outstanding academic achievement and provide an opportunity for the brightest and most promising girls in rural Africa to develop substantial and meaningful careers through a university or post-secondary school education. Educating girls is one of the fastest and most effective ways of promoting global economic development, and the key to

ultimately ending poverty and injustice for women. It is also one of the highest return investments in the developing world.

As part of our Pay It Forward program, One Girl Can university graduates return to their former high schools to mentor the next generation of girls.

Last week, Emily returned to Mbooni High School for the first time in 10 years. She shared her story and reminded students of the importance of working hard, and not allowing their circumstances to define their future.

The Cycle of Empowerment continues.

Meet Velma, a 14-year-old girl from rural Kenya with big dreams.

This past March, during a visit to our partner schools in Kenya, our CEO Michelle met Velma, who immediately stood out. She was curious and full of questions.

Velma shared that she was writing a book about a girl who, against all odds, received an education and changed the world. Then she asked Michelle: “Can you help me find a publisher?”

Seven weeks later, Michelle shared Velma’s story on stage at the conference.

Then Diane walked into the One Girl Can activation. Not only did Diane offer to help Velma pursue her dream of becoming an author, she also sponsored Velma’s full high school education.

Thank you Diane for opening a door so one girl can change the world.
